
Pride celebrations
Pride celebrations are events that honor and support the LGBTQ+ community, celebrating diversity, acceptance, and equal rights. Originating from the 1969 Stonewall Riots, these festivities include parades, festivals, and educational activities that promote visibility and awareness. They serve as a reminder of the ongoing fight for LGBTQ+ rights and provide a space for individuals to express their authentic selves freely. Pride events foster community solidarity, highlight achievements, and advocate for equality, helping to create a more inclusive society where everyone’s identity is respected.
